"Stefan Monnier" <monnier+gnu/address@hidden> writes:

> And on top of that, we can easily do something about it by including
> something like cygwin-mount.el.

The problem with doing that IMHO, is that if Emacs supports Cygwin
paths in the 99% of cases that cygwin-mount.el covers, users will
expect Cygwin paths to work in 100% of cases.  Until someone can
spend the time to make Cygwin paths work in the remaining 1% of
cases, it is better that cygwin-mount.el remains external to Emacs,
so that expectation is not there.
